Wagstaff Recruitment is seeking an Employment Solicitor to join their prestigious team in Oxford. The role offers an attractive salary of £84,000-£95,000 per annum, with full-time contract terms.

Candidates should possess 2-5 PQE in employment law, combined with strong interpersonal skills and a professional pedigree. This position provides a chance to work alongside some of the top professionals in the field within a supportive and collegial environment.

How to prepare for a job interview at Wagstaff Recruitment

Know Your Employment Law Inside Out

Make sure you brush up on the latest developments in employment law. Given the role's focus, being able to discuss recent cases or changes in legislation will show your expertise and enthusiasm for the field.

Showcase Your Interpersonal Skills

Since strong interpersonal skills are a must, think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ully navigated challenging conversations or built relationships. This will help demonstrate that you're not just knowledgeable but also a great team player.

Research the Firm's Culture

Wagstaff Recruitment values a supportive and collegial environment, so do your homework on their culture. Be ready to discuss how your values align with theirs and how you can contribute positively to their team dynamic.

Prepare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, you'll likely have the chance to ask questions. Prepare insightful ones that reflect your interest in the role and the firm, such as inquiries about their approach to professional development or how they handle complex employment cases.
